Suzlon Lands 50 MW BPCL Wind Project in Madhya Pradesh

Suzlon Energy has been awarded a 50 MW wind power project in Madhya Pradesh by Bharat Petroleum Corporation Ltd. (BPCL), a Navratna PSU, as part of BPCL’s green energy transition strategy. An additional 50 MW project in Maharashtra was awarded to Integrum Energy Infrastructure. Both projects aim to meet the captive power needs of BPCL’s Bina and Mumbai refineries, supporting its goal of a 10 GW renewable energy portfolio by 2040.

BPCL has reaffirmed its commitment to becoming a Net Zero Energy Company for Scope 1 and Scope 2 emissions by 2040. This contract adds to Suzlon’s strong order book, which stood at 5,622 MW as of March 28, 2025.

In April, Suzlon also secured two major orders: 100.8 MW from Sunsure Energy and 378 MW from NTPC Green Energy, reinforcing its leadership in India’s renewable energy sector.
